Most people think tattoo machines just like sewing machines - rotating needles up and down with hollow needles, but it is not true.
Actually, tattoo machine is essentially an electromagnet powered by a variable power supply. The artist dips the needs into a small cap which has been filled with pigment (ink) from a squeeze bottle. There are from one for some outlines and fine work to many bunched needles tight together for shading in a given tattoo machine. The needles are soldered to a bar which is attached to the electromagnet.
The word, Tattoo, comes from the Polynesian word, tatao which means to tap or to mark something.
Captain James Cook introduced this word to the English during his voyage around the world in 1769. Captain Cook and his crew of the ship, The Endeavour, were welcomed with open arms by the friendly and uninhibited Tahitians (yeah, that means many of them were naked.) Since the weather was very warm on the island, clothing was optional.
The Tahitians tried to look their best by decorating their bodies. But the fact of the matter was the application of tattoos, which was painful. It was done by dipping a sharp-pointed comb into lampblack and then hammering it into the skin. Nonetheless, everybody did it.
Cherry blossom tattoos are some of the most popular tattoo designs for women currently. The beauty and delicate nature of a cherry blossom can?t be denied. In both Japanese and Chinese cultures the cherry blossom is full of symbolic meaning and significance. Before deciding to get a cherry blossom tattoo design it makes sense to understand the symbolism and deep cultural connections and meaning that this tattoo might hold. After all the best tattoo designs are ones that hold a great deal of symbolic significance. Typically the tattoo that is universally regretted is the one that was gotten while out with a bunch of friends just because they were getting one. So don?t fall into the trap and regret your tattoo later in life. Instead if you are planning on getting a tattoo at least take the time to research the symbolism and meaning behind it and see if it speaks to you and if the ideas are significant in your life.

I see today that they’re making a Ghost Rider movie. I discovered Ghost Rider when I was about thirteen years old, at my regular haunt, Collector’s Comics of Wantagh, New York. I was a late bloomer to comic books, having been introduced to them by my D&D buddy, Marc Koenig. Like most things new in my life, I quickly became hooked and soon after, obsessed. I started small, with X-Men, Daredevil, and Thor. Oh, and I was lucky enough to be there for the Wolverine miniseries. The X-Men were about to embark on their second fight with the Brood, Daredevil was looking for direction after his lover had died, and I can’t remember what was happening to poor Thor. What I do remember, though, was that crossovers got me to buy more books, and if I bought an issue I bought into the series. I was a Marvel man all the way, and they played me like a fiddle. At sixty cents an ish, I was soon spending twenty bucks a week and was a member of the discount club, adding to the savings I got by preordering my subscriptions. One of those that I ordered was Ghost Rider, the continuing story of the much-cursed Johnny Blaze, host to a demon motorcyclist.

Whether you are into tattoo by hobby or are looking to make it your profession, you have the need for good, quality tattoo starter kits. This article will tell you what to look for.
When you are first getting into being a tattoo artist on a personal and hobby-related level, purchasing the right equipment might seem daunting. A tattoo starter kit is the best way to get all the tattoo equipment you need without spending too much money. A good tattoo starter kit should include a tattoo machine, needles, tubs and tattoo ink. Make sure your tattoo machine comes with the right power supply as well.
